Abstract
An infrared soap dispensing faucet structure comprises a shell and an automatic soap dispensing unit. The shell has a hollow vertical section with a first space and a hollow horizontal section with a second space. A water outlet and a soap outlet are arranged at an outer lower edge of the horizontal section. The water outlet has a first sensor and the soap outlet has a second sensor. The first sensor of the water outlet is provided for controlling the water outlet to be turned on and off. The shell and the automatic soap dispensing unit are integrated with each other so that a bathroom space is not in disarray and dirt remained on hands is not polluted a faucet or the automatic soap dispensing unit.
Claims
1. An infrared soap dispensing faucet structure, comprising a shell and an automatic soap dispensing unit; the shell has a hollow vertical section and a hollow horizontal section; a first space is defined in the vertical section and a second space is defined in the horizontal section; a water outlet and a soap outlet are separately arranged at an outer lower edge of the horizontal section; an inlet pipe is arranged in the first space and the second space for providing to output water flow and has an inlet valve; the water outlet has a first sensor and the soap outlet has a second sensor; the first sensor of the water outlet is provided for controlling the water outlet to be turned on and off; the automatic soap dispensing unit has an output set, a container, and an electric control set; the output set is connected with the container and the soap outlet; the electric control set is connected with the output set and the second sensor for providing soap to output to the soap outlet; further characterized in that: the shell and the automatic soap dispensing unit are integrated with each other so that a bathroom space is not in disarray and dirt remained on hands is not polluted a faucet or the automatic soap dispensing unit; and the automatic soap dispensing unit has an air pump, the output set includes an air inlet pipe, a foaming unit is arranged at the soap outlet, the soap is flowed from the output set to the soap outlet and the foaming unit, the air pump is pumped air into the foaming unit, air and soap are mixed in the foaming unit, and soap is flowed out in a manner of micro foam.
